Step-by-step explanation:
In this problem, the total number of marbles in the bag is 10 (4 blue + 3 red + 3 yellow). The probability of drawing a blue marble is the number of favorable outcomes (drawing a blue marble) divided by the total number of outcomes.
So, the probability of drawing a blue marble is
or 40%. This is because there are 4 blue marbles, and the total number of marbles is 10.
